Masquerade
by Walter SatterthwaitPinkerton agents Phil and Jane #2 ...... France, mostly Paris, 1923. The Pinkerton Detective Agency has been hired to investigate the supposed murder/suicide of a wealthy Frenchman and his German mistress. So Phil and Jane go to France to do the investigation and along the way encounter Ernest Hemingway and Gertrude Stein, among others. I loved this fascinating, witty, and altogether wonderful mystery. Highest recommendation, 5 stars.

This classic short story, An Occurrence at Owl Creek Bridge, by Ambrose Bierce, takes place during the American Civil War and is well worth a read today.
